On moral grounds Meaning in English
expression
Definición
To do something or make a decision because of what you believe is right or wrong, based on your moral values.
Uso & Matices
Used to justify or explain actions, refusals, or objections by appealing to personal or societal morals. Often appears after verbs like 'refuse', 'object', or 'oppose': 'refused on moral grounds'. More formal and often used in debates or policy discussions.
